    <title>2019 (5) TMI 1577 - CESTAT MUMBAI</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=380849</link>
    <description>Classification and exemption under heading 5407 6190 could not be disturbed where the department relied on test material that was not properly produced, disclosed, or shown to be reliable. The imported goods had been cleared on the basis of the Textile Committee report, and later contrary reports were not part of a transparent evidentiary record. Because the importer was not given notice of the specific remnant samples or the basis of re-testing, and the available reports were inconsistent, the foundation for denying Notification No. 36/2003-Cus benefit was not established. The declared assessment and relief to the importer were therefore upheld.</description>
